Marinated Coleslaw
This recipe serves:  6

Ingredients
1 head of cabbage, finely shredded
1 large onion, finely sliced
1 cup white wine vinegar
1/4 cup canola oil
3/4 cup sugar
2 teaspoons salt
1 tablespoon dry mustard
1 tablespoon celery seeds
2 cups chicken broth, low-sodium


Cooking Instructions
1. Layer the cabbage with the onions in a non-reactive container by placing one third of the cabbage in the container, then half of the onions, another third of the cabbage, the remaining onions and finally the remaining cabbage.

2. Bring the remaining ingredients to a boil and pour them over the cabbage mixture. Do not mix. Marinate for 6 to 8 hours or overnight in the refrigerator.

3. Toss the marinated cabbage mixture as if it were a salad. Serve chilled.

Serving Size: about 1/2 cup

Nutritional Information
Number of Servings: 6
Per Serving
Calories 146 Carbohydrate 24 g
Fat 5 g Fiber 3 g
Protein 3 g Saturated Fat 0 g
Sodium 430 mg
